Transaction e656137628e585b029b803ff84fa0eaae5a794d451edde75c85e6a1afbb1bf2e
1 Input
1 Output
-
e656137628e585b029b803ff84fa0eaae5a794d451edde75c85e6a1afbb1bf2e:0
- value
- 4259
- script pubkey
- OP_0 OP_PUSHBYTES_20 b997023eec861a9369aa6479d9d3a0daf0f59591
- address
- bc1qhxtsy0hvscdfx6d2v3uan5aqmtc0t9v3m652qh